Description

Fort Worth's future public library system will be among the many displays of city services that will be open to the public during a series of showings. Mrs. Edith Hurley, head of the library's children's department, will be on hand at the opening to tell some of Hans Christian Andersen's stories. Fort Worth Star-Telegram Evening edition May 15, 1965.
